  • Patent number: 6032385
    Abstract: A dryer section in a papermaking machine has two reversing rolls to form a pocket between each pair of dryers in a dryer tier. The first reversing roll is a vacuum roll and the second reversing roll is a grooved roll. A blow box is disposed between the two rolls, the blow box provides suction for the grooved roll and provides vacuum which restrains a web on the dryer fabric as it travels between the first and the second rolls. The blow box also provides a supply of make-up air which extends in a cross machine direction along the pocket formed by the two reversing rolls. The blow box also supports a pivoting foil which is positioned against the dryer fabric as it moves from a first dryer, towards the first reversing roll. The foil defines a region of low pressure which restrains the web as it travels between the first dryer and the first reversing roll.

  • Patent number: 5873180
    Abstract: A single tier dryer system has dryer rolls with a reversing roll positioned between each pair to transfer and wrap the dryer felt and paper web against the next dryer roll. A vacuum box is positioned between the dryer rolls and over the reversing roll to hold the web on the dryer felt by vacuum. Threading of a tail from the web is accomplished by blowing the web tail off a first dryer roll's surface with a jet of air positioned adjacent to the position on the dryer roll where the dryer felt leaves the dryer roll's surface. The vacuum box is divided by a baffle to isolate a portion of the vacuum box near the front of the dryer rolls, and a damper is positioned within the reversing roll to increase the vacuum in the isolated portion of the vacuum box to facilitate threading of the tail.

  • Patent number: 5699626
    Abstract: Disclosed is a method for reducing the moisture content of a paper web in a papermaking process from in the range of 10% to 32% dry to the range of 33% to 50% dry wherein the embryonic web is supported on a knuckled through drier fabric and lightly pressed between the knuckled through drier fabric and a capillary membrane of a capillary dewatering roll. The capillary membrane has capillary pores therethrough which have a substantially straight through, non-tortuous path with a pore aspect ratio of from about 2 to about 20. A vacuum is drawn within the capillary dewatering roll which is not greater than the negative capillary suction pressure of the capillary pores.

  • Patent number: 5535527
    Abstract: A method for causing adherence of a web to a drying wire so as to prevent the effects of centrifugal forces and of other air-flow phenomena, which effects attempt to separate the web from the drying wire in dryer groups having a single-wire draw and arranged in a multi-cylinder dryer of a paper machine. The dryer groups include heated drying cylinders, a drying wire for pressing the web against outer cylinder faces of the drying cylinders, and guide cylinders or rolls on which the web runs on the outside face of the drying wire. The guide cylinders have perforations which pass through the cylinder mantle and open into an inside space in the interior of the guide cylinders which is subjected to a vacuum. The vacuum in the guide cylinders is transferred to the outside face through the perforations. The guide cylinders have shafts on which the guide cylinders are mounted revolving.
